What to expect at a service at Alrington Cumberland Presbyterian Church


Presbyterians worship in the Reformed tradition — Word-centered, theologically rich, and dignified.

  • Services last 60–75 minutes. Expect Scripture-heavy readings, a teaching sermon, congregational hymns, and prayer.
  • Communion is typically monthly or quarterly, open to all who trust Christ.
